Output 5f39fc58956652e3a73a64ae90f129d6eef9e94a50a90acdbbfcf16f5ff60836:42

value
147459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dcfd384139c9c4e5fb9e4bac95c963e579f9fa3 OP_EQUAL
address
3JzebpVNxpYBY5oM2eVWcn3mkuWJCTSchc
transaction
5f39fc58956652e3a73a64ae90f129d6eef9e94a50a90acdbbfcf16f5ff60836
spent
true